Benny Daon is a veteran software engineer and serial founder with over 17 years of professional experience and more than four decades of programming practice, now leading Asimi as Co-Founder & CEO while advising startups through Tuzig. He blends hands‑on backend and test-automation expertise (Go, Python, TypeScript; Redis, MongoDB, PostgreSQL) with a deep commitment to software quality, eXtreme Programming, DORA metrics and developer satisfaction. Benny builds friction‑free development environments and bespoke test frameworks—he’s implemented docker-compose, pytest, Playwright and custom tooling—and actively hunts technical debt while mentoring teams. A long-time open-source contributor and co-founder of the influential Open-Knesset project, he has experience scaling volunteer-driven civic projects and steering product strategy for both startups and institutions. Known for turning operational and process challenges into measurable improvements, he pairs practical engineering with a knack for teaching and clear documentation.
